This book serves as a practical guide for physicians interested in the application of high frequency currents, stepping away from overly technical discussions to focus on hands-on, applicable knowledge. It navigates through the history and development of high frequency currents, elucidating their definition, generation, and the apparatus involved. With an emphasis on practicality, the author draws upon nineteen years of experience using these currents daily and sixteen years teaching the subject to offer insights into their physiological effects, therapeutic applications across various diseases and conditions, and specialized techniques for different body areas.
By positioning high frequency currents within both a historical context and their evolving role in medical treatment, this work contributes significantly to understanding their broader implications. The thematic depth explores not just the mechanical aspects but also delves into patient care standards like asepsis and dosage standardization. Furthermore, it discusses advanced applications such as diathermy and its relevance in dentistry.
Conclusively, this book stands as an essential resource for medical professionals seeking to integrate high frequency current therapies into their practice efficiently and effectively. It encapsulates a blend of rich experiential knowledge with practical advice, making it an indispensable tool for physicians looking to enhance their therapeutic arsenal.
